Kyungtae Park is a scholar working on Biomedical Engineering, Biomaterials and Molecular Biology. According to data from OpenAlex, Kyungtae Park has authored 37 papers receiving a total of 694 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Biomedical Engineering, 7 papers in Biomaterials and 6 papers in Molecular Biology. Recurrent topics in Kyungtae Park’s work include Advanced Sensor and Energy Harvesting Materials (7 papers), Microplastics and Plastic Pollution (6 papers) and Polymer Surface Interaction Studies (4 papers). Kyungtae Park is often cited by papers focused on Advanced Sensor and Energy Harvesting Materials (7 papers), Microplastics and Plastic Pollution (6 papers) and Polymer Surface Interaction Studies (4 papers). Kyungtae Park collaborates with scholars based in South Korea, United States and United Kingdom. Kyungtae Park's co-authors include Jinkee Hong, Yuxia Zhang, Li Wang, Hyejoong Jeong, Daheui Choi, Li Wang, Ping Xu, David D. Moore, Yunhee Choi and Jiansheng Huang and has published in prestigious journals such as ACS Nano, Gastroenterology and Chemistry of Materials.
